- vinumveritas - 03-15-2000

Agree with Bucko. Actually I worked at William Hill until a couple of years ago, so I can definitely verify that! Trivia: There was actually a 1985 Cab Rsv, Gold label and Silver label made. The 1985 Reserve was considered pretty excellent in its time, but had already faded appreciably when I first tasted it in 1997. The Gold was the next level down, and the Silver label was not exactly the "pick of the litter" to begin with... pour it out!
